Question
what is the largest natural sink (source or repository) of nitrogen?
the tundra
the desert
the air
the ice caps
Brief Explanations
Earth's atmosphere (the air) is composed of approximately 78% nitrogen gas ($N_2$), making it by far the largest natural reservoir of nitrogen. Other options like tundra, deserts, and ice caps hold only tiny fractions of the total global nitrogen compared to the atmosphere.
